Mr. Vogel represents injured victims and concentrates his practice in complex civil litigation and trials, including medical negligence, product liability and workplace accidents. He also handles motor vehicle accident and premises liability matters, such as slip/trip and falls.

Mr. Vogel earned his Bachelor's degree from Bowling Green State University in 1992 and his law degree from Temple University School of Law in 1995. He is licensed to practice law in both Pennsylvania and New Jersey, and admitted in the United States Supreme Court, United States Court of Appeals for the Third Circuit, United States District Court for the Eastern District of Pennsylvania, and the United States District Court for the District of New Jersey. Mr. Vogel is also a Fellow of the Academy of Advocacy, 2003.

Mr. Vogel is a proud member of the American Trial Lawyer's Association, Pennsylvania Trial Lawyer's Association and Philadelphia Trial Lawyer's Association, as well as the American Bar Association and Pennsylvania Bar Association.

Mr. Vogel has been voted by his peers as a Pennsylvania SuperLawyer Rising Star in 2005, 2006 and 2007. Only 2.5% of Pennsylvania attorneys receive this honor.

Mr. Vogel has achieved many significant verdicts and settlements for his clients. For example:

  • a $2,600,000 unanimous jury verdict, which Mr. Vogel was able to have upheld on appeal, in Sell v. Ingersoll Rand Company, 2004 WL 633274 (E.D.Pa. 2004), affirmed, 2005 U.S.App. LEXIS 12935 (3d Cir. 2005), reh'g denied (3d Cir. 2005)
  • a $1,640,000 total recovery in Tellado v. Roto-Die, Inc., et al., Phila. CCP, April Term, 2004, No. 1459
  • a $1,010,000 total recovery in Johnson v. Mitsubishi Heavy Industries, Ltd., et al., Phila. CCP, July Term, 2002, No. 2637
  • a $1,625,000 award and recovery in a combination medical malpractice, product liability and negligence case captioned as Estate of Gholami v. Chapman Enterprises, Inc., et al., Phila. CCP, December Term, 2003, No. 2622
